Arranged by Ben Folds and with Joe Jackson as guest vocalist, Star Trek’s Captain Kirk talks his way through Pulp’s ‘Common People’. The results are every bit as bad as they sound. Shatner “acts out” Cocker’s depiction of a slumming rich kid, devaluing the song in the process. It’s similar to the way American versions of British sitcoms drain the lifeblood out of the original. Horrible stuff.
